MURPH v. BD. OF PROBATION AND PAROLE


164 Pa.Commw. 28 (1994)

641 A.2d 1275

Joel E. MURPH a/k/a James Springs, Petitioner, v. PENNSYLVANIA BOARD OF PROBATION AND PAROLE, Respondent.

Commonwealth Court of Pennsylvania.

Decided May 9, 1994.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Al Flora, Jr., for petitioner.

No appearance for respondent.

Before CRAIG, President Judge, and KELLEY, J., and DELLA PORTA, Senior Judge.


CRAIG, President Judge.

Joel Murph, also known as James Springs, is a convicted parole violator serving his sentence in the State Correctional Institution at Dallas. He has filed a petition for review of a decision of the Pennsylvania Board of Probation and Parole dated August 14, 1991, that denied his request for administrative relief in the form of credit against his sentence for time served.
